WebFeb 5, 2024 · Use "méi yǒu" (没有) to say you don't have something. This phrase, pronounced "may-ee yooh," is used when someone asks you if you have something and you don't. It's also used if someone asks you if you've been to a place or experienced something and you haven't. It literally means "not have." WebNov 23, 2024 · 2. 您好 Nínhǎo Hello (polite). Many beginning students of Chinese will have learned that the formal way to say hello is 您好 (nínhǎo). If you're new to Chinese, you can remember that 您好 is used to show respect by noticing that the only difference between 你 and 您 is that the 您 in 您好 has 心 (xīn), the Chinese character for heart, underneath it.
